Output 91a66afcb4ca866e23cd80c6500d99c4d5378737b0fc53ca93f296b438ff5e69:2

value
791225000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7558a6f2cc45140b02296144d0d19983a83d0db3 OP_EQUALVERIFY OP_CHECKSIG
address
1BhUG6yU3QZENwnQLpsNqNFiVpqNhM4uFg
transaction
91a66afcb4ca866e23cd80c6500d99c4d5378737b0fc53ca93f296b438ff5e69
spent
true